The Seahawks' journey in Seattle has been a rollercoaster ride. Back in 1996, the team faced a potential move to Southern California, but a strong community effort and the intervention of the NFL kept them in the Emerald City. Microsoft co-founder Paul Allen's purchase of the franchise the following year is widely seen as a pivotal moment that secured the Seahawks' future in Seattle.

Tragedy struck in 2018 when Paul Allen passed away after a battle with cancer. His younger sister, Jody Allen, stepped in as executor of his estate, taking on the responsibility of overseeing the Seahawks and the Portland Trail Blazers. Jody's plan, as revealed by King County Executive Girmay Zahilay, aligns with her late brother's wishes to eventually sell both teams and donate the proceeds to charity.

Zahilay expressed gratitude for the Allen family's stewardship of the Seahawks, highlighting their success and the team's deep connection with the community. He trusts that the new owner will keep the Seahawks rooted in Seattle, playing at Lumen Field.
